  2. Oct 18, 2023 · Method 2: Factory Reset Using Recovery Mode Requirements. You will need access to the hardware keys, specifically the volume buttons, of your locked Android phone. Steps. Power off the mobile device. Simultaneously press the volume control and power buttons to enter Recovery Mode. Use the volume buttons to navigate to ‘Wipe data/factory reset’.

    To remove all data from your phone, you can reset your phone to factory settings. Factory resets are also called “formatting” or “hard resets.”

    Important: Some of these steps work only on Android 9.0 and up. Learn how to check your Android version.

    Important: A factory reset erases all your data from your phone.

    If you're resetting to fix an issue, we recommend first trying other solutions.

    Know Google Account username & password

    To restore your data after you reset your phone, you must enter security info. When you enter the info, it shows that you or someone you trust did the reset.

    1. Be sure that you know a Google Account on the phone.

    • Open your phone's Settings app.

    On most phones, you can reset your phone through the Settings app. If you can't open your phone's Settings app, you can try factory resetting your phone using its power and volume buttons.

    We recommend checking your manufacturer's support site for device-specific instructions.
